AT THE ROOT OF TOOTH PAIN

In cases in which tooth decay is left untreated, bacteria may infect the tooth pulp and lead to an abscess. Symptoms include aching or throbbing pain in the tooth, sensitivity to hot or cold, chewing pain, and fever. At this point, endodontic (root canal) treatment is indicated. This involves removal of the nerve and vascular tissue (pulp) from the root and pulp chamber, as well as any associated decayed tooth structure. This allows the tooth to be spared from extraction. After the inside of the tooth is carefully shaped and cleaned, it is filled and sealed, awaiting a crown. Preserving the tooth root in this fashion helps avert the bone loss that often accompanies loss of the tooth root.

Root canal treatment is highly successful. Many teeth fixed with a root canal can last a lifetime. This column has been brought to you in the interest of better dental health. OF GROWING RELEVANCE

If you were to lose a tooth due to trauma, infection, decay, or periodontal disease, wouldn’t it be great if you could simply grow a replacement tooth? After all, when sharks lose teeth, the ones from the row behind them move in to take their places. Scientists doing research on the matter think that the possibility exists. In fact, geneticists have recently discovered the gene responsible for switching on the replacement-tooth mechanism. The so-called Osr2 gene resides below the top layer of gum tissue (epithelium) in mesenchymal tissue, where it combines efforts with two other genes to form budding teeth. Manipulating this gene is no doubt a tricky matter, but who knows what the future may hold?

SMOKELESS NOT HARMLESS

A recent study shows that use of snuff and chewing tobacco by adolescent boys in this country has surged over the past few years. According to a report from the U.S.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ration, there has been a 30 percent increase in the rate of smokeless tobacco use among boys aged 12-17 years over a recent five-year period. This finding is worrying on at least two important fronts: First, smokeless tobacco is as addictive as cigarettes and does not assist in weaning oneself from smoking. Second, using smokeless tobacco products increases the risk of oral cancer. Because dentists are usually the first to see signs of oral cancer, they have a stake in preventing it.

Up to a certain point, if you quit, your body can heal itself…but the longer you use spit tobacco, the bigger your risk of getting cancer. Don’t let it be too late!
